光催化自洁净玻璃的研制

摘    要:用溶胶-凝胶法制备了表面镀有Ag-TiO2光催化薄膜的自洁净玻璃,并利用XRD,SEM等方法研究了光催化薄膜的结构与特征,考察了不同银含量以及不同膜厚度对自洁净玻璃光催化活性的影响。研究结果表明:光催化薄膜主要由20-100nm的Ag和TiO2颗粒构成;掺入适量银,可提高光催化活性,在Ag]/TiO2]=2/50(浓度比)时为最好。在Ag]/TiO2]=2/50时,膜厚为0.87μm时光催化活性最高。

PREPARATION OF PHOTOCATALYTIC SELF_CLEANING GLASS

Abstract:The self_cleaning glass with Ag-TiO2 photocatalytic thin film coated on slide glass was prepared by sol-gel progress from the system TiO(C4H9)4-NH(C2H4OH)2-C2H5OH-H2O containing AgNO3. The microstructure and properties of the films were studied by SEM and XRD. The effects of the amount of Ag_addition and the thickness of the Ag-TiO2 thin film on the photocatalytic activity were examined. The results show that the photocatalytic thin film is mainly composed of Ag and TiO2 particles of 20—100 nm, at [Ag]/[TiO2]=2/50, the highest photocatalytic activity is obtained for the film with a thickness of 0.87 μm.
